Don’t look away from Myanmar suffering, Pope pleas

"Let us ask God in prayer for consolation for this tormented population."

“For a year now, we have been watching the violence in Myanmar with sorrow,” Pope Francis said at the end of the February 2 general audience, as that country marks a year since the military coup.

The Pope continued:

I echo the appeal of the Burmese bishops for the international community to work for reconciliation between the parties concerned. We cannot look away from the suffering of so many brothers and sisters.

Let us ask God in prayer for consolation for this tormented population. To him we entrust our efforts for peace.
